Here's a little factoid for ya, Excals have virtually a life time warranty for anything but stupidity. Guys are getting 20 yr old bows warranteed when needed.
The only down side to the bow posted is it's carved limb tips vs molded, which means it can only use dacron strings, which means it shoots about the same fps as a Phoenix. there are several people that have dry-fired Excals and split a limb, myself included that got them replaced for free under warranty by being honest. Try that w/ a compound.
